
HEALTH, SAFETY & ENVIRONMENT AND ITS GROWING IMPORTANCE IN TODAY’S TIMES

HSE refers to a system, which looks at protecting the environment and maintaining health and safety of individuals. Several organizations and governments around the world are acknowledging the importance of adopting HSE measures in view of ensuring good health and safety for their employees.
The Safety aspect involves making organized efforts for identifying workplace hazards and reducing accidents and exposure to harmful situations. The Health aspect, on the other hand, involves the development of safe, high quality, and environmentally friendly processes to reduce the risk of harm to people. Environment here involves creating processes to ensure compliance with environmental regulations.
HSE DURING COVID TIMES
With the onset of pandemic, maintaining and following COVID protocols has become critical and is identified to be the most effective way of combating the pandemic. Following norms like social distancing, wearing masks and using sanitizers is absolutely essential to maintain a safe environment for others and ourselves.
Making workplaces secure as the pandemic rages on around us is another important aspect that would fall under the purview of HSE. Ensuring safety protocols at work and other organizations could go a long way in the fight against COVID. This would minimize risk posed to workers and those who are most vulnerable to the impacts such as school going children.
